Product Description

Fibre Core Conformal Coated Wirewound Resistor - SPP Series

The SPP Series Fibre Core Conformal Coated Wirewound Resistors are designed for applications requiring reliable performance and fusing capabilities. These resistors are UL1412 recognized and feature weldable and solderable leads, making them suitable for various assembly processes. They offer a wide resistance range and are available with high temperature coefficients upon request. The flameproof fusible nature is indicated by a blue band on the marking.

Product Attributes

  • Brand: TT Electronics / BI Technologies / IRC / Welwyn
  • Certifications: UL1412 recognised (UL number E234469), RoHS3 compliant (for Pb-free parts)
  • Construction: Fibre Core, Conformal Coated, Wirewound
  • Lead Type: Weldable and solderable
  • Marking: Five colour bands (Value, Multiplier, Tolerance, Flameproof Fusible Blue Band)
